qt 4.3-20070530, WinXP - shortcut letters as specified by tr("&Save") do not get underlined


Message 1 in thread

...works find on linux (openSUSE 10.2 x86_64)

the shotcuts still work though

you can easily reconstruct this by creating a QMainWindow in the designer, 
adding an action to the menubar and preview the form

This is a "feature" of XP. Pressing Alt will cause the underline to appear. I 
believe there is a setting somewhere in XP to turn this off, too.

If my memory serves right, right click on Desktop, 
Settings->Appearance->Advanced effects button and its in one of the 5 or 
so checkboxes in the modal dialog that comes up :)
